Initiates the SSL/TLS handshake as a client in non-blocking manner.
# emulates blocking connect begin ssl.connect_nonblock rescue IO::WaitReadable IO.select([s2]) retry rescue IO::WaitWritable IO.select(nil, [s2]) retry end
By specifying a keyword argument exception to false, you can indicate that connect_nonblock should not raise an IO::WaitReadable or IO::WaitWritable exception, but return the symbol :wait_readable or :wait_writable instead.
Initiates the SSL/TLS handshake as a server in non-blocking manner.
# emulates blocking accept begin ssl.accept_nonblock rescue IO::WaitReadable IO.select([s2]) retry rescue IO::WaitWritable IO.select(nil, [s2]) retry end
By specifying a keyword argument exception to false, you can indicate that accept_nonblock should not raise an IO::WaitReadable or IO::WaitWritable exception, but return the symbol :wait_readable or :wait_writable instead.
A non-blocking version of sysread. Raises an SSLError if reading would block. If “exception: false” is passed, this method returns a symbol of :wait_readable, :wait_writable, or nil, rather than raising an exception.
Reads length bytes from the SSL connection. If a pre-allocated buffer is provided the data will be written into it.
Writes string to the SSL connection in a non-blocking manner. Raises an SSLError if writing would block.
